Julia Wolfe’s music is distinguished by an intense physicality and a relentless power that pushes performers to extremes and demands attention from the audience. Dig Deep, Wolfe’s iconic composition for string quartet, generates an intense sonic movement. In his response to the composition, Israeli choreographer and dancer Arkadi Zaides focuses on a state of ongoing oscillation, offering the audience a kinesthetic, non-narrative practice, examining the tension between restlessness and stability in his body. By zeroing in on this tension, Zaides wishes to ‘dig deep’ and unearth a somatic response to personal experiences of immigration, homelessness and in-betweenness.
The music will be performed live by the Quatuor Leonis (France) whose interdisciplinary approach has led them to be compared to the renown Kronos quartet.

Under the Influence of Music : From the Marx Brothers to the modern mind


Featuring: Elena Mannes (Writer and filmmaker / US), Peter Szendy (Philosopher / FR)


What are the connections between music and the body? How do song and noise affect human nature? Two thinkers travel from the outer ear to the inner mind and give their personal insights on this intriguing topic. Filmmaker and writer Elena Mannes explores the impact of music on brain, philosopher Peter Szendy studies the use of music in film, particularly in Mickey Mouse cartoons and in Marx Brothers movies.
